A Private Nature Reserve

What sets Gaia apart is its commitment to conservation. The hotel is located within a 14-acre private nature reserve, once home to a wildlife rescue center. Today, guests can explore marked jungle trails with expert naturalists, who point out sloths, toucans, monkeys, and an array of tropical flora. Every step feels like a guided meditation through biodiversity.

Gaia also supports scarlet macaw conservation efforts—visitors might spot these vibrantly colored birds soaring overhead as part of a successful local reintroduction program.

Q&A: Planning Your Stay at Gaia Hotel & Reserve

Q: What’s the best time to visit Gaia Hotel & Reserve?
A: The dry season (December to April) offers plenty of sunshine, perfect for pool lounging and wildlife spotting. However, the green season (May to November) brings lush landscapes and fewer crowds.

Q: Is Gaia suitable for solo travelers or only couples?
A: While Gaia is a favorite among honeymooners, it also caters beautifully to solo travelers and small groups, offering privacy, wellness experiences, and guided excursions tailored to all kinds of explorers.

Q: What kinds of excursions are offered nearby?
A: Gaia can arrange waterfall hikes, zip-lining, mangrove tours, and surfing lessons at nearby beaches. Manuel Antonio National Park, known for its biodiversity and scenic trails, is just a 10-minute drive away.
